Rosa setigera, Native Climbing Rose, Prairie Rose

Rosa setigera, Native Climbing Rose, Prairie Rose is a shrub or climbining vine found in dry to moist forests, woodlands, prairies, bluffs, old fields, in short, wherever it wants to grow in its relatively broad range in eastern North America. The fragrant flowers are light to rosy pink, and quite large, to 3 inches across. The relatively small rose hips are edible. This native slimbing rose is found in the nursery trade. Quite hardy and relatively free from disease.
